Identifying Fraudulent Appointment Letters

With the growing concern over fake appointment letters, it's essential for applicants to familiarize themselves with the official documents. Here are a few tips on what to look out for:

  • Check for official seals or logos.
  • Verify contact information against official NYS Cadet channels.
  • Look for inconsistencies in formatting or language.
  • Consult trusted sources if unsure about a document’s validity.
